titleOfInvention | Liquid crystal display |
abstract | A liquid crystal display device having an optical anisotropic body and a liquid crystal cell between a pair of polarizers in which the respective absorption axes are substantially perpendicular to each other, the optical anisotropic body measured with light having a wavelength of 550 nm when the slow axis direction of the refractive index n x in each plane, the slow axis and the direction of the refractive index perpendicular in the plane n y in the plane, the refractive index in the thickness direction is n z, n z > n x > ny , and the optical anisotropic body is made of a layer containing a material having a negative intrinsic birefringence value, and the in-plane slow axis of the optical anisotropic body is disposed in the vicinity. A liquid crystal display device having a positional relationship substantially parallel or substantially perpendicular to an absorption axis of the polarizer. It is excellent in antireflection, scratch resistance and durability, has a wide viewing angle, and provides high contrast with a uniform display when viewed from any direction. |
